Introduction to AI Domains
Artificial Intelligence becomes intelligent according to the training it gets. For training, the machine is fed with datasets. According to the applications for which the AI algorithm is being developed, the data fed into it changes.
With respect to the type of data fed in the AI model, AI models can be broadly categorized into three domains:
- Statistical Data (SD)
- Computer Vision (CV)
- Natural Language Processing (NLP)

Statistical Data
Statistical Data is a domain of AI related to data systems and processes, in which the system collects numerous data, maintains data sets and derives meaning/sense out of them.
The information extracted through statistical data can be used to make a decision about it.
Example of Statistical Data:
Price Comparison Websites
- These websites are being driven by lots and lots of data. The convenience of comparing the price of a product from multiple vendors in one place.
- Examples: PriceGrabber, PriceRunner, Junglee, Shopzilla, DealTime are some examples of price comparison websites.
- Nowadays, price comparison websites can be found in almost every domain such as technology, hospitality, automobiles, durables, apparel, etc.
Computer Vision (CV)
Computer Vision is a domain of AI that depicts the capability of a machine to get and analyse visual information and afterwards predict some decisions about it.
- The entire process involves image acquiring, screening, analysing, identifying and extracting information.
- This extensive processing helps computers to understand any visual content and act on it accordingly.
- In computer vision, Input to machines can be photographs, videos and pictures from thermal or infrared sensors, indicators and different sources.
- Computer vision-related projects translate digital visual data into descriptions.
- This data is then turned into computer-readable language to aid the decision-making process.
- The main objective of this domain of AI is to teach machines to collect information from pixels.

Example of Computer Vision:
Agriculture Monitoring
- Computer vision is employed in agriculture for crop monitoring, pest detection, and yield estimation.
- Drones with cameras capture aerial images of farmland, which are then analysed to assess crop health and optimize farming practices.

Surveillance Systems
- Computer vision is used in surveillance systems to monitor public spaces, buildings, and borders.
- It can detect suspicious activities, track individuals or vehicles, and provide real-time alerts to security personnel.
Natural Language Processing (NLP)
Natural Language Processing, abbreviated as NLP, is a branch of artificial intelligence that deals with the interaction between computers and humans using the natural language.
- Natural language refers to language that is spoken and written by people, and natural language processing (NLP) attempts to extract information from the spoken and written word using algorithms.
- The ultimate objective of NLP is to read, decipher, understand, and make sense of human languages in a valuable manner.
Examples of Natural Language Processing
- Email filters:
Email filters are one of the most basic and initial applications of NLP online. It started with spam filters, uncovering certain words or phrases that signal a spam message.
- Machine Translation:
NLP is used in machine translation systems like Google Translate and Microsoft Translator to automatically translate text from one language to another.
These systems analyze the structure and semantics of sentences in the source language and generate equivalent translations in the target language.
